Description:
The LM35DT is a temperature sensor that converts temperature information into a linear voltage output. It has a 10mV/°C scale factor, which means that for every 1°C change in temperature, the output voltage will change by 10mV. The sensor has a low output impedance, making it easy to interface with a wide range of microcontrollers and signal processing circuits.
